Ritual of Doom
Spell shadow antimagicshell
  • Ritual of Doom
  • 30 yd  range
  • 30 minutes cooldown
  • 80% of base mana
  • 10 sec cast
  • Reagents: Demonic Figurine
  • Begins a ritual that sacrifices a random participant's health to summon a doomguard. Requires the caster and 4 additional party members to complete the ritual. In order to participate, all players must right-click the portal and not move until the ritual is complete.

In Patch 4.0.1, Ritual of Doom is removed from the game. This page is for historical purposes.



Ritual of Doom is a Warlock spell that sacrifices a significant portion of a participant's health for the benefit of summoning a Doomguard.

The Doomguard summoned from the ritual will be under the control of the warlock for 15 minutes and despawns after that time has elapsed. This is in contrast to the Doomguard that spawns from the proc of Curse of Doom which needs to be enslaved and will break free from enslavement after a certain amount of time has elapsed.

Learned from a [Grimoire of Doom] or N Warlock [60] Suppression.

Patch changes[]

  • Template:Patch 4.0.1
  • Patch 1.6.0 (patch date:2005-07-12): Should now display the cooldown. 
  • Patch 1.4.0 (patch date:2005-05-05): Can now be learned from N Warlock [60] Suppression
  • Patch 1.3.0 (patch date:2005-03-07): The death caused at the completion of the ritual no longer causes durability loss.
